site stats

Preorder and inorder of a tree

WebFeb 17, 2024 · 1. What is tree traversal? Tree traversal is the process of visiting each node in a tree data structure in a specific order. There are three common orders of tree traversal: … WebJul 5, 2024 · What is a Preorder traversal? Tree traversal means visiting all the nodes of a tree exactly once. Visiting can be interpreted as doing something to the node, for example, printing the value contained in it. Pre-order traversal is one of the many ways to traverse a tree. It is mainly used when a tree needs to be duplicated.

Construct a tree from Inorder and Level order traversals Set 1

Web下载pdf. 分享. 目录 搜索 WebMar 6, 2024 · You can use an array or vector to store the inorder and preorder tree traversal. Input: Inorder Array and Preorder Array are given as input, Preorder[] = [10,20,40,50,30] Inorder[] = [40,20,50,10,30] In the case of Inorder traversal, we traverse the tree following this pattern: Left; Root; Right mayor\u0027s office on criminal justice https://tomanderson61.com

binary tree, tree, inorder, preorder - Coding Ninjas

WebJan 18, 2024 · Push the root node in the stack with status as 1, i.e {root, 1}. Initialize three vectors of integers say preorder, inorder, and postorder. Traverse the stack until the stack … WebApr 16, 2010 · Create a new tree node tNode with the data as the picked element. Find the picked element’s index in Inorder. Let the index be inIndex. Call buildTree for elements … WebGiven 2 Arrays of Inorder and preorder traversal. The tree can contain duplicate elements. Construct a tree and print the Postorder traversal. Example 1: Input: N = 4 inorder[] = {1 6 … mayor\u0027s office on returning citizens

Construct a binary tree from Preorder and inorder traversal

Category:Construct a Binary Tree from a given Preorder and Inorder traversal …

Tags:Preorder and inorder of a tree

Preorder and inorder of a tree

Learn how to traverse a Tree (Inorder , Preorder , Postorder)

WebOct 12, 2012 · Use it like this: (preorder tree) > ' (+ 1 * 2 - 3 5) The other two traversals are very similar, just rearrange the three arguments for append in the correct order for each … Web2.考虑具体递归内容,即中止条件和递归过程与返回值。. 我们想要的是,以“root”为根节点时,所有可能的树的构建,那么思考一下发现,这个结果等于 以“左孩子”为根节点时所有构建数 * 以“右孩子”为根节点时,所有的构建数,那么递归的返回值就可以 ...

Preorder and inorder of a tree

Did you know?

WebIf you look at how we Construct a Binary Tree from a given Preorder and Inorder traversal, you will understand how the binary tree is constructed using the traversal sequences given to us. If one tries to observe, the first thing we do is find the root first. After finding the root, we can now split the traversals into 3 parts: the left, root ... WebQuestion: CS 560-HW 8: Binary Search Trees and Red-Black Trees Question 1: CLRS (12.1-4): Implement python functions using recursive algorithms that perform inorder, preorder and postorder tree walks in \( \Theta(n) \) time on a tree of \( n \) nodes. Question 2: Implement python functions for both TREE-INSERT and TREE-DELETE using recursive approach.

Web22 hours ago · 105. 从前序与中序遍历序列构造二叉树 Construct-binary-tree-from-preorder-and-inorder-traversal. 给定两个整数数组 preorder 和 inorder ,其中 preorder 是二叉树的先序遍历, inorder 是同一棵树的中序遍历,请构造二叉树并返回其根节点。 示例 1: WebThis set of Data Structure Multiple Choice Questions & Answers (MCQs) focuses on “Preorder Traversal”. 1. For the tree below, write the pre-order traversal. 2. For the tree below, write the post-order traversal. 3. Select the …

WebThe solution hast to be handwritten. Question 2: Find the Inorder, Preorder Postorder and Breadth-first tree traversals for the following BST Tree . The solution hast to be … WebGiven the preorder and inorder traversals of a binary tree, construct and return the binary tree. Example Testing Input Format. The first line contains an integer T denoting the number of test cases. For each test case, the input has 3 lines: The first line contains an integer n denoting the length of the arrays.

WebApr 14, 2024 · 1) 이진 트리(Binary Tree) ① 기본 이진 트리 - 모든 노드의 차수(degree)가 2 이하인 트리 - 트리는 child노드를 갖고 그 child 노드들로부터 부분트리를 가질 수 있기 때문에 본질적으로 재귀적인 성질이 있다. → 추가적으로 재귀적인 성질을 완성하기 위해 '빈트리도 이진트리이다'(터미널 조건)라는 정의도 ...

WebJan 26, 2024 · In this tutorial, we will use the Inorder, Preorder, and Post order tree traversal methods. The major importance of tree traversal is that there are multiple ways of … mayor\u0027s office on returning citizen affairsWebApr 3, 2024 · In-order traversal: 24,17,32,18,51,11,26,39,43. Pre-order traversal: 11,32,24,17,51,18,43,26,39. The question asked to find which nodes belong on the right … mayor\u0027s office omaha neWebThere are three types of recursive tree traversals: preorder, inorder and postorder. This classification is based on the visit sequence of root node 1) Preorder traversal: root is visited first 2) Inorder traversal: root is visited after left subtree 3) Postorder traversal: root is visited last. These are also called depth first search or DFS traversal. mayor\u0027s office on returning citizens dcmayor\\u0027s office on returning citizen affairsWebFeb 2, 2024 · Binary Tree Traversal in Data Structure Explained Binary Inorder, Preorder and Postorder and an easy time-saving shortcut to solve it. mayor\\u0027s office on disability sfWeb152 Likes, 2 Comments - FRESHFARM (@freshfarmdc) on Instagram: "Farming is undoubtedly hard work, but now many of our farmers are loading in hours and hours of a..." mayor\\u0027s office on returning citizens dcWeb标签: 题目: Given preorder and inorder traversal of a tree, construct the binary tree. 思路: 线序序列的第一个元素就是树根,然后在中序序列中找到这个元素(由于题目保证没有相同的元素,因此可以唯一找到),中序序列中这个元素的左边就是左子树的中序,右边就是右子树的中序,然后根据刚才中序序列中 ... mayor\u0027s office ottawa